Question about the Basic Civic Integration Exam Abroad

Hey guys,

I have a question on how my answers should be on the speaking part of the Exam.

Let's say they ask: "Hoe laat stopt u met werken?"

Can I answer like "7 uur" / "7 uur 's avonds" or should it be more complete like "Ik stop om 7 uur met werken"?

Do I need to repeat words from the question? Does it count on the evaluation? Or can/should I keep it simple?

I've just checked the Naar Nederland examples on YouTube, it says on the opening slide that "Uw antwoord kan kort zijn", so you can give short answers as long as they answer the question properly, without confusion.
